Getting There
-
Public Transport - Tram
To reach Karl Johan-monumentet using the tram, first find your way to a nearby tram stop. If you are near Oslo Central Station (Oslo S), you can take tram line 12 or 19 in the direction of Majorstuen. Get off at the 'Nationaltheatret' stop. From there, walk towards Karl Johans gate (the main street) and head northeast. The monument is located in the middle of the square, where you will see the impressive statue.
-
Walking
If you prefer to walk, start from Oslo Central Station. Exit the station and head towards the main street, Karl Johans gate. It is a straight path and will take approximately 10-15 minutes to walk. As you walk, you will pass by various shops and cafes. Continue walking until you reach the square where Karl Johan-monumentet is located, right in front of the Parliament building.
-
Public Transport - Bus
You can also take a bus to reach Karl Johan-monumentet. Find the nearest bus stop and take bus line 30 or 31 towards 'Bjørvika'. Get off at 'Stortinget' stop. From there, walk a short distance to Karl Johans gate and the monument will be visible in front of you.
